Understanding the Philippine Stock Exchange Index (PSEI)
The Philippine Stock Exchange Index (PSEI) is essentially a barometer of the Philippine stock market. It reflects the overall performance of the top 30 publicly listed companies in the country, selected based on specific criteria like market capitalization and liquidity. Think of it as a snapshot of the health of the Philippine economy, viewed through the lens of its biggest companies. Monitoring the PSEI is crucial because it provides insights into market trends and investor sentiment.
When the PSEI is trending upwards, it generally indicates that investors are optimistic about the economy and corporate earnings are strong. Conversely, a downward trend suggests potential economic headwinds or investor concerns. However, it's super important to remember that the PSEI is just one piece of the puzzle. It shouldn't be the sole basis for your investment decisions. Diversification, research, and understanding your own risk tolerance are key.
The PSEI's composition is reviewed periodically to ensure it accurately represents the market. Companies can be added or removed based on their performance and adherence to the criteria. This dynamic nature means that investors need to stay updated on the index's constituents to make informed decisions. The performance of these 30 companies collectively offers a broad indication of how the Philippine stock market is faring, making it an essential tool for both local and international investors. Delving into Agora Se Investimentos Bradesco
Now, let's shift our focus to Agora Se Investimentos Bradesco. This is a prominent investment platform offered by Bradesco, one of the largest financial institutions in Brazil. Agora provides a wide array of investment products and services, catering to various investor profiles, from beginners to experienced traders. It's designed to empower individuals to manage their investments effectively and achieve their financial goals.
One of the standout features of Agora is its comprehensive online platform. It allows users to access real-time market data, conduct research, and execute trades seamlessly. The platform also offers educational resources, such as webinars, articles, and tutorials, aimed at enhancing investors' knowledge and skills. This is super useful, especially if you're new to the investment world and need a bit of guidance.
Agora's product offerings include stocks, bonds, mutual funds, and other investment vehicles. This diverse range enables investors to diversify their portfolios and align their investments with their risk tolerance and financial objectives. Furthermore, Agora provides personalized investment advice through its team of experienced financial advisors. These advisors can help investors develop tailored strategies based on their individual circumstances and goals. Risks and Considerations
Investing always involves risks, and it's crucial to be aware of these before putting your money into any venture. Understanding the risks and considerations associated with both the PSEI and platforms like Agora is vital for making informed decisions.
When it comes to the PSEI, keep in mind that it's a market index, and its performance can be influenced by a variety of factors, including economic conditions, political events, and global market trends. A downturn in the Philippine economy, for example, could lead to a decline in the PSEI. Similarly, unexpected political instability or a global financial crisis could also negatively impact the index. Therefore, it's important to stay informed about these factors and be prepared for potential market volatility. Remember, past performance is not necessarily indicative of future results.
Platforms like Agora, while offering access to a wide range of investment options, also come with their own set of risks. One of the main risks is market risk, which is the risk that the value of your investments will decline due to market fluctuations. This is an inherent risk in any investment, but it's particularly relevant when investing in stocks or other volatile assets. Another risk to consider is liquidity risk, which is the risk that you won't be able to sell your investments quickly enough when you need to. This can be a concern if you're investing in less liquid assets, such as real estate or certain types of bonds.
